Output 43d7399646ee640edd08312b07521a60b64c0b1e2ead577326ad6d42d7a6e590:0

value
27564103
script pubkey
OP_0 OP_PUSHBYTES_20 908d1215e2989cb364c239ae7100e004f03b5346
address
bc1qjzx3y90znzwtxexz8xh8zq8qqncrk56x042267
transaction
43d7399646ee640edd08312b07521a60b64c0b1e2ead577326ad6d42d7a6e590